Dynamic network management (DNM) delivers a systems thinking capability to our drainage area teams. To put it simply it collects data from our assets, third party assets and the environment. Real time transfer of that data to a central location. Application of descriptive, diagnostic and predictive analytics to identify any deviations in the system that are likely to result in a loss of volume the network. The ultimate goal to understand the complete network, its constituent parts within the broader system and how we ensure it delivers exceptional services to customers whilst protecting the environment. In order to achieve this vision by 2022 UU will need to deploy c. 20,000 monitors into the sewer network including monitoring the performance of c. 3,000 pumping stations. The monitored points would be the following: Rain Gauge Sewer Level Monitor CSO Pumping Stations Simple Monitoring Pumping Stations Advanced Monitoring Pumping Stations Pro-Active Monitorig Detention Tank Pumped Return (offline) Detention Tank (in sewer) Storm Water Tank (WwTW) United Utilities is exploring new ways of working with suppliers in acquiring such data and less traditional commercial models – to that end, information is requested from suppliers who have the ability/experience in delivering some or all of the above data in a Data as a Service (DaaS) model.
